Agentic AI involves creating a system of interacting agents, each trained on a specific task or dataset. These agents can communicate, negotiate, and collaborate to solve complex problems. For example, AI can spot recurring or unnecessary costs, detect maverick spending (when employees purchase outside of approved channels), and identify opportunities for cost savings based on historical spending patterns.
